Quick View Add to Cart Science & Nature Science and Nature Small Red Eyed Green Tree Frog R$15.37 Add to Cart
Quick View Add to Cart Science & Nature Science and Nature Red Eyed Green Tree Frog Keychain R$19.26 Add to Cart